Yun Yee Lim is a Casual Teaching Lecturer at the School of Psychological Science, The University of Western Australia (UWA). Her research focuses on neuropsychology, brain injury, and social psychology mechanisms like the halo effect and attachment styles.
Education:
- Master of Professional Psychology (Curtin University, 2023)
- Bachelor of Social Sciences (Honours) in Psychology (2021)
Research Interests: Explores cognitive and behavioral outcomes post-brain injury, including fatigue-sleep-cognition interplay. Also investigates social perception dynamics through attachment styles and halo effects. Utilizes experimental paradigms to study priming effects on judgment and decision-making.
Publications Overview: Recent work examines how social distancing impacts halo effect perceptions and attachment styles' role in social cognition. Ongoing projects include systematic reviews on neurorehabilitation following acquired brain injuries.
